After having a nightmare with coilovers I've decided to go with ebach springs.

Wondered if anyone had any experience with with the 30mm rear and 45mm front springs?

Mostly everyone on this with ebach have 30mm all round. Can't see anyone with the 45mm front version.

Or should I just take that as a sign ha

take it as a sign mate, lol

30mm all round is a nice drop but its also the lowest you want to go. speed bump are a slight issue but any lower and they would be impossible
